Campo Juice + Kitchen, Denver

Campo Juice + Kitchen is a bright RiNo wellness cafΓ© where cold-pressed juices, nourishing bowls, and warehouse-district creativity meet in one refreshingly modern atmosphere.

Set along Larimer Street near the intersection with 35th Street amid RiNo's mural-covered warehouses, design studios, and cafΓ©-lined sidewalks, this airy health-forward kitchen captures the side of Denver that treats wellness less like discipline and more like lifestyle rhythm. The space feels dynamic. Sunlight pours across clean wood tables, blenders hum steadily behind the counter, and plates layered with fresh greens, grains, citrus, and energetic sauces move through the room with almost architectural precision. Everything carries a sense of lightness, not only in the food itself but in the mood surrounding it. Laptop users settle in beside post-workout regulars and weekend cafΓ© crowds drifting through RiNo, all moving at a noticeably calmer pace than the nightlife-heavy streets outside. Campo channels the energy of a neighborhood increasingly shaped by design, movement, and intentional living.

Campo Juice + Kitchen built its character around nutrient-focused meals and cold-pressed juices while maintaining the social warmth and visual polish expected from one of RiNo's most design-conscious corridors.

The menu leans into fresh produce, layered textures, and naturally bright flavor combinations rather than restrictive wellness messaging or minimalist health culture. Smoothies blend tropical fruit, greens, nut milks, and functional add-ins into drinks that feel energizing without becoming overly clinical, while grain bowls, avocado toasts, salads, and protein-forward plates balance freshness with enough substance to function as full meals rather than cafΓ© snacks. The design mirrors that same philosophy. Clean lines, natural materials, and abundant light create a space that feels open and restorative. RiNo itself shapes much of the atmosphere surrounding the cafΓ©. The district's transformation from industrial warehouse zone into one of Denver's defining creative neighborhoods produced an ecosystem of galleries, studios, coffee shops, breweries, and wellness concepts all existing within a few walkable blocks of one another. Campo fits naturally into that landscape, offering a version of wellness culture that feels integrated into daily urban life.

Campo Juice + Kitchen works as a reset point between exploring RiNo's galleries, boutiques, breweries, and constantly evolving street-art corridors.

Stop in during the late morning or early afternoon when natural light fills the cafΓ© and the neighborhood outside moves at a slightly slower pace before evening nightlife begins taking over the district. Start with a cold-pressed juice or smoothie, then settle into one of the cafΓ©'s bowls or lighter plates while allowing the atmosphere to recalibrate the day. The experience pairs especially well after a workout, long walk, or morning spent wandering RiNo's murals and creative storefronts nearby. Even the pacing inside encourages balance. Conversations remain relaxed, music stays soft enough for focus, and the room carries the steady energy of people intentionally slowing themselves down for an hour. Campo leaves behind a distinctly contemporary impression of Denver, one shaped not by excess or performance, but by movement, creativity, and the growing desire for spaces that make daily life feel healthier and more grounded.
